Increasing the level of physical activity in adults and children is a state and national objective. The National Institutes of Health report that more than one-half of American adults are overweight. Since 1980, the national percentage of overweight young people has doubled - considered by the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ention to be an epidemic of obesity. Adequate physical activity is essential to good health and is considered to be a protective factor against conditions such as heart disease and cancer. While physical activity of any kind is beneficial, walking is one form that people of all ages can perform and enjoy. Beaver Dam Lake Bike Route Directions: while circumnavigating Beaver Dam Lake on a bicycle is certainly possible, it is not recommended. This is, however, the route that one of our Leadership Beaver Dam friends use when he needs a peaceful place to ride. The road closest to the lake on the North and East side of the lake is State Hwy. 33. This highway has narrow shoulders and is heavily used by semi-trucks with a 55 mph speed limit, therefore it is not recommended as a bicycle route. The West and Southern border of the lake lends itself to a much more pastoral country setting for a bike ride. Following madison Street out of town to County G allows a bike rider access to lightly used roads that lead to the lake shore (although none are through streets). County G can be followed by County C into Fox Lake, for a one way trip of approximately 20 miles.
